Agbonlahor shares insight on Idrissa Gueye after Everton update via BBC – ‘He was with me at Villa’

Gabriel Agbonlahor has backed Idrissa Gueye to be a “very good signing” for Everton if he completes a move this summer.

Speaking exclusively to Football Insider, the ex-Aston Villa forward recalled his time playing with the 32-year-old during his time at Villa Park.

Gueye signed for Everton in 2016, after a year with Villa, for a fee of around £7.5million.

According to the BBC (3 August), the Toffees are in advanced talks with Paris Saint-Germain over a deal to re-sign the midfielder.

The Senegal international left Everton for PSG in 2019.

He has entered the final year of his contract with the Ligue 1 champions.

The Merseyside club have already lost Fabian Delph, Donny van de Beek and Richarlison in the summer transfer window.

When asked if he thought Gueye would be a welcome addition to Frank Lampard’s side, Agbonlahor told Football Insider: “Yes, I do.

I really liked him as a player. He was at Villa with me and let me tell you he is a very, very good player.

PSG are maybe wanting to go in a different direction now.

He’s very good on the ball, can get around the pitch can get the ball back. He’d be a very good signing for Everton.

The midfielder made 33 appearances for the French Ligue 1 side last season across all competitions.

During those outings he scored four goals and provided one assist.
